Food Pan Materials and Performance
| Feature | Stainless Steel Pan | Polycarbonate (Clear) | High-Heat Plastic (Amber) |
| Durability | Extremely High; resists dents | High; shatter-resistant | Moderate; can crack over time |
| Temperature Range | $-40^\circ\text{C}$ to $260^\circ\text{C}+$ | $-40^\circ\text{C}$ to $99^\circ\text{C}$ | $-40^\circ\text{C}$ to $190^\circ\text{C}$ |
| Best Usage | Ovens, Grills, Steam Tables | Cold Buffets, Salad Bars | Microwaves, Warm Holding |
| Odor Resistance | Excellent (Non-porous) | Good | Moderate |
| Visual Clarity | None (Opaque) | Excellent (Transparent) | Fair (Translucent) |
| Dishwasher Safe | Yes | Yes | Yes |
Tips for Maintaining Your Professional Kitchen Gear
To ensure your food pan collection lasts for years, you should follow a few simple maintenance steps that prevent corrosion and unsightly staining. Even though stainless steel is highly resistant to rust, leaving acidic foods like tomato sauce or vinegar in the pans for extended periods can eventually pit the metal. It is best to wash them with a non-abrasive sponge to keep the surface smooth, which also makes it easier for food to slide out during serving. If you notice a white, cloudy film on your plastic pans, this is often caused by hard water or high-heat drying cycles in the dishwasher; a quick soak in a mild vinegar solution can often restore their clarity. Always check the corners of your pans for any cracks or sharp edges that could harbor bacteria or cause injury to staff.
FAQs
1. What are the standard sizes for these pans?
The most common size is the “Full-Size” pan, which measures approximately 12 by 20 inches. From there, they are divided into fractions like 1/2, 1/3, 1/4, 1/6, and 1/9. This allows you to fit multiple smaller pans into the same space that one full-size pan would occupy.
2. Can I put a plastic food pan in the oven?
Standard clear polycarbonate pans are strictly for cold or room-temperature storage and will melt in an oven. However, there are special “High-Heat” pans (usually amber or black) that can withstand temperatures up to 375°F. Always check the manufacturer’s stamp on the bottom before heating.
3. What does “anti-jam” mean in the product description?
Anti-jam pans have specially designed ridges or “lugs” near the top edges. These prevent the pans from creating a vacuum seal when they are stacked together, making it much easier to pull them apart when you are in a hurry.
4. Why should I choose stainless steel over aluminum?
Stainless steel is much more durable and does not react with acidic foods like tomatoes or lemons. Aluminum is a great heat conductor but can sometimes leave a metallic taste in certain dishes and is more prone to denting and warping over time.
